6726802457664 has 189 divisors, whose sum is σ = 19661467009093. Its totient is φ = 2198881611264.
The previous prime is 6726802457659. The next prime is 6726802457671. The reversal of 6726802457664 is 4667542086276.
The square root of 6726802457664 is 2593608.
It is a perfect power (a square), and thus also a powerful number.
6726802457664 is a `hidden beast` number, since 6 + 7 + 268 + 0 + 245 + 76 + 64 = 666.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in only one way, i.e., 4849332494400 + 1877469963264 = 2202120^2 + 1370208^2 .
It is a Duffinian number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 26 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 3299068357 + ... + 3299070395.
Almost surely, 26726802457664 is an apocalyptic number.
6726802457664 is a gapful number since it is divisible by the number (64) formed by its first and last digit.
6726802457664 is the 2593608-th square number.
It is an amenable number.
It is a practical number, because each smaller number is the sum of distinct divisors of 6726802457664
6726802457664 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(12934664551429).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
6726802457664 is an frugal number, since it uses more digits than its factorization.
6726802457664 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 4202 (or 2097 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 162570240, while the sum is 63.
The spelling of 6726802457664 in words is "six trillion, seven hundred twenty-six billion, eight hundred two million, four hundred fifty-seven thousand, six hundred sixty-four".
